5. Your Rights as a Data Subject

Under the Data Privacy Act, you have the following rights:

  • Right to be informed – know how your data is being collected and processed.
  • Right to access – request a copy of your personal data.
  • Right to rectify – correct inaccurate or outdated information.
  • Right to erase or block – request deletion of data when no longer necessary.
  • Right to object – opt-out of direct marketing and data sharing.
  • Right to file a complaint – with the National Privacy Commission for any violation of your data privacy rights.
